Is the Boxer Movement progressive or backward?
The boxer movement is a spontaneous movement of the masses.

The Boxer Rebellion was a large-scale mass violence movement in China at the end of 19 with the slogan of "helping the Qing Dynasty to destroy the foreign countries", targeting westerners in China, including missionaries and Christians in China.

The boxer movement is generally characterized by backwardness, ignorance and inhuman atrocities.

The Boxer Rebellion can't reflect the patriotic spirit of China people against imperialist aggressors and unequal treaties, because ignorance and indiscriminate killing account for the vast majority in the whole movement, and there are almost no troops that really resist western aggressors.

The Boxer Rebellion is of progressive significance to the awakening of national consciousness in modern China.

The Boxer Rebellion marks the awakening of China's national consciousness in the modern sense and is the origin of modern nationalism in China.

The Boxer Movement, the May 4th Movement and the May 30th Movement are the three major mass nationalist movements in modern China to resist imperialist aggression.
